About Checkr
Checkr is building the data platform to power safe and fair decisions. Established in 2014, Checkr’s innovative technology and robust data platform help customers assess risk and ensure safety and compliance to build trusted workplaces and communities. Checkr has over 100,000 customers including DoorDash, Coinbase, Lyft, Instacart, and Airtable.
We’re a team that thrives on solving complex problems with innovative solutions that advance our mission. Checkr is recognized on Forbes Cloud 100 2024 List and is a Y Combinator 2024 Breakthrough Company.
About the team/role
We are seeking a seasoned Staff Data Scientist to drive user acquisition, activation, and retention. You will utilize math, grit, and the latest GenAI tools to accelerate insights, streamline workflows, and iterate rapidly on growth hypotheses, to move the needle since the Data Science team is a critical driver of Checkr’s growth. By leveraging advanced analytics and machine learning, this role has ample headroom to bend the curve of our user acquisition, activation, and retention, playing to our already strong competitive advantages.
As a Staff Data Scientist on our Growth team, you love leading the debate with rigor and data, through a dense cross-functional team, and being the direct owner of all the analytics, ML models, and experimental roadmap that turbocharge user acquisition, activation, and retention for Checkr
What you’ll do
- PLG Funnel & Experimentation: Define north-star growth metrics, design A/B tests, and run rapid experiments to boost conversion and reduce churn
- Deep analysis and insights automation: Leverage LLMs and GenAI frameworks to accelerate data exploration, prototype predictive models, generate hypotheses, and build the right pipelines to automate it all
- Data-Driven Feature Work: Collaborate with Eng, Product, Marketing, RevOps, and Design to launch ML-powered features (e.g., personalized onboarding flows, predictive lead scoring, recommendation)
- Ship DS in production: This is not a lab job; you will build and deploy models in production
What you bring
- 10+ years of hands-on data science or machine learning or growth analytics experience in a fast-scaling B2B/SaaS
- Fluent in Python, SQL, and modern MLOps and data CI/CD practices
- Knows your math
- Proven track record designing and running high-impact experiments that move key growth metrics
- Familiarity with GenAI tools (e.g., LLMs, automated feature generation, prompt engineering, MCPs) to supercharge productivity
- Proven communication and stakeholder management skills; can lead Exec conversations
- A provocative, scrappy, test-and-learn mindset: you love speed, creative data wrangling, and challenging assumptions

At Checkr, we believe a hybrid work environment strengthens collaboration, drives innovation, and encourages connection. Our hub locations are Denver, CO, San Francisco, CA, and Santiago, Chile. Individuals are expected to work from the office 2 to 3 days a week. In-office perks are provided, such as lunch four times a week, a commuter stipend, and an abundance of snacks and beverages.
One of Checkr’s core values is Transparency. To live by that value, we’ve made the decision to disclose salary ranges in all of our job postings. We use geographic cost of labor as an input to develop ranges for our roles and as such, each location where we hire may have a different range. If this role is remote, we have listed the top to the bottom of the possible range, but we will specify the target range for an exact location when you are selected for a recruiting discussion. For more information on our compensation philosophy, see our website.
The base salary range for this role is $196,000 - $230,000 in San Francisco, CA.
